Transactional Finance Administrator
Qualification: Level 3 Business Administrator Apprenticeship
Location: Ashford Kent
Working hours: 37.5 per week
Our Apprenticeship Programme is not one size fits all. Just like our delicious food, our scheme is carefully prepared to help you learn more, experience more and succeed more.
The Business Administrator Level 3 apprenticeship programme is a fantastic opportunity to learn whilst working, including supporting and engaging with different parts of the organisation and communicating with key stakeholders. When joining the Credit Control Team as an Administrator Apprentice you will get hands on experience with clients and is a great way of progressing towards management responsibilities as part of career development.
Support will be given throughout your apprenticeship with mentors guiding you through the role and continuous development of skills and behaviours to exceed personal goals and business objectives.
The apprenticeship will provide on the job training, where you will apply new skills and knowledge gained to real life operations such as:
Handle all inbound customer calls & emails in a polite & empathetic manner
Ensure all customer queries are dealt with effectively & efficiently
Maintain effective liaison with a range of internal staff & customers and keeping accurate records of all correspondence
Assist Credit Control with their portfolio of accounts when required
Skills and competencies required:
Experience with Microsoft packages – ideally prior knowledge of SAP
Experience of having worked in a fast moving, pressurised team environment with a large volume of inbound calls
Excellent customer service & administrative skills.
High level of accuracy and attention to detail
Excellent interpersonal & problem-solving skills
Reliable team player
GCSE 3/D/Level 1 in Maths and English
Benefits
Sysco Perks: Access hundreds of discounts, cashback deals and exclusive offers at High Street stores, restaurants, cinemas, and attractions through LifeWorks Perks.
Employee assistance helpline and wellbeing portal - Access confidential support, resources and services for your mental, physical, social, and financial wellbeing, any time, 24/7.
Excellent work life balance including additional holiday - Purchase up to 5 additional days annual leave per year.
Cycle to Work Scheme
This role requires no previous finance experience as training will be provided. As part of the application process, you will be asked to complete an online psychometric task, which will be sent to you by the recruitment team
